WebMay 1, 2003 · The triptans are all very similar in many aspects; however, kinetic profiles differ from drug to drug. Frovatriptan’s beneficial pharmacokinetic difference from the other triptans is its long half-life. Frovatriptan’s disadvantage is a slower onset of action. WebJun 13, 2024 · Rizatriptan (Maxalt): Available in oral tablets and oral dissolving tablets. It has the fastest onset of action for oral triptans but also has the highest rate of recurrence after usage. Rizatriptan may be a good option if your attacks come on fast but don’t last long. Almotriptan (Axert): Available in oral tablets.
